Ingredients
- 2 whole potatoes 1 bowl of cool water filled quarter full
- 4 whole eggs 1 pinch of parsley(optional)
- 2 slices of cheese
- 1 oz. of pepper
- 4 oz. of butter or margarine
Details
Servings 2
Level of difficulty Average
Preparation time 10mins
Cooking time 45mins
Cost Average budget
Preparation
Step 1
cut the very top and bottom of the potatoes
throw it away then peel them next cut them small (but not to small) and place the pieces into a bowl of cool water.
Step 2
Strain the potatoes and then place in hot pan with butter
or oil.
Step 3
After the potatoes are to your liking meaning soft enough
add your two eggs with pepper mixed, on to your potatoes and let the egg fry Next put your 2 slices of cheese on top and flip it over
Step 4
Last add the parsley and on to the plate for your enjoy ment

Chef Tips and Tricks
Combine summer zucchini with leftover mashed potatoes for a delicious, savory treat!
INGREDIENTS
- 5 Potatoes
- 1.5 Cup shredded zucchini
- 3/4 Cup shredded cheese
- 3/ Cup milk
- 1/3 Cup coriander, chopped
- 1/3 Cup basil, chopped
- Parmesan, to sprinkle
- Salt and pepper, to season
METHOD
- Chop the potatoes in half, boil until very tender and drain.
- In a bowl, combine the potatoes and zucchini. Add the grated cheese, milk, coriander, basil, salt and pepper, and mix thoroughly.
- On a baking tray, spoon out the zucchini-potato mixture and form into balls.
- Sprinkle with Parmesan and grated cheese, and bake at 350°F for 15 minutes.
- When golden, remove from oven... and enjoy!
